Odemwingie Hoping Hull City Will Be His Fourth Premier League Club
Published: July 20, 2016
Peter Odemwingie is hoping to return to the English Premier League with newly promoted Hull City, having spent a portion of last season at Bristol City.
The 35-year-old was monitored during Tuesday’s friendly between the Tigers and Mansfield Town, and was in action for 27 minutes after replacing Maloney.
With the scoreboard reading 1-0, the Nigeria international was unlucky not to double Hull City’s advantage when his shot struck
the post in the 83rd minute.
Meanwhile, the striker is enjoying his trial at the KC Stadium outfit and thanked his fans for wishing him all the best.
Odemwingie said on Twitter : “Thanks for wishing me good luck @HullCity. Read all the tweets. First two days have been wonderful â�½ï¸�ð��¯.”
The Bendel Insurance product started off his career in England with West Brom before spells at Cardiff City and Stoke City.
